Anime, originating from Japan, has become a global website obsession that continuously expands to different parts of the world.

They have influenced not only the entertainment industry by their inherent narrative technique and extraordinary character progression, they also have inspired countless forms of media, fashion, and art around the globe.

Diverse in nature, anime features an extensive variety of genres to suit every demographic and taste.

From the action-packed world of Shonen to the heart-wrenching slices of life in Shojo, anime series come in all shapes and sizes.

Benchmark series such as Naruto, One Piece, and Attack on Titan underline anime's potent influence in the global pop culture scene.

On the other hand, new releases like Demon Slayer and Jujutsu Kaisen are fast gaining traction, depicting a promising prospect for the anime industry.

From being a fringe pastime, anime has transitioned into a mainstream obsession in recent years.

Anime appeals to millions of devotees worldwide, with events like anime conventions, merchandising, and cosplay becoming part of their lifestyle.

Alongside anime's rising popularity, intrigue in the Japanese culture flourishes, thereby cultivating relationships and promoting understanding between various cultures.

To sum it up, anime has definitively gone beyond being "cartoons" in the traditional sense – it has become a cultural, artistic, and social phenomenon.
